“Science Literacy Week highlights Canada’s outstanding scientists and science communicators from coast-to-coast. The goals are to showcase the excellence and diversity of Canadian science and to show how exciting science is."
# K! d7 T0 l4 X# @% m* \As part of Science Literacy Week, Kids Code Jeunesse will be running free workshops for kids across Canada from Sept 18th – Sept 24th in Libraries and community centres to introduce children to science and code.
